**Vendor note: Inkmill markdown pipeline**

Rendering for Parchway docs is outsourced to Inkmill under an annual contract, renewing each March. They handle sanitization and PDF export; we own the upload queue. SLA: 4-hour response on rendering failures. Escalate only after two failed retries. Their support desk is reachable at the address below.

billing contact of hahaf-baguf = zorael.tammir.jorius@sivrelhq.internal

// Heads up for release: these contrast ratios came out of the
// Glimmerhatch accessibility audit in March. Anything below 4.5:1
// on body text is a blocker, per Orla's sign-off rules. Don't
// tweak MIN_CONTRAST_RATIO without re-running the full palette
// sweep — the secondary button hover state is already borderline.
// The audit run that validated this constant is identified by the
// trace token directly below.

session token of taduf-tahog = htk4_91a1

Ticket #2281 — Duplicate alerts in Stormrelay fan-out

Welcome aboard — context for your first ticket. The Stormrelay weather-alert fan-out occasionally delivers the same severe-weather notice twice to subscribers in the Harrowfield region. We suspect the retry path in the dispatcher re-enqueues messages that already succeeded. Please reproduce using the staging feed, check the idempotency-key handling, and document findings carefully. The suspect build token appears below.

build token for fafof-haweg: htk9_fa5a15142

Handover note — shuttle gate, Brindlemoor Depot

Hi Tove, quick one before I head off: the contractors from the cladding job arrive Monday. The shuttle-bus gate scanner is still flaky, so wave them through to the side panel instead. They'll need the visitor pass code, which works until Friday. It's the one below.

staff pass of kawip-hawef = bdg-QLP-2